Font Pairing: Balancing Playfulness and Professionalism
To balance the playful nature of Silly Kids, I paired it with a clean, modern sans serif font for body text and other supporting elements. This combination allowed the brand to maintain a professional appearance while still feeling approachable and fun. The contrast between the two fonts created a visually appealing and well-structured design.
